Hi Everyone...

Yup... sounds like a panic attack. Have you had them before the banding incident? You should speak to your regular doctor about this and get a little support! they are no fun and you shouldn't suffer so badly.

I actually had an "unfill" at post op day #11 due to some problems, I'll admit, (even though I'm a nurse) when I saw that needle coming I thought "what the...." Wow... that's a big needle... however... it was only a tiny little pinch when it went in and when it goes into the port... you feel a tiny little "pop" with no pain what so ever. Weird feeling... but it was all ok!!!

I wish you well! GREAT weight loss... but wow... it's a bit too much since surgery!! That's a pound a day. Make sure you are having enough Protein, so you're not losing muscle instead of fat! Well done!
